# # This file is autogenerated by pip-compile with Python 3.8 # by the following command: # # make upgrade # appdirs==1.4.4 # via # -r requirements/test.txt # fs arrow==1.2.3 # via # -r requirements/test.txt # jinja2-time asgiref==3.6.0 # via # -r requirements/test.txt # django astroid==2.15.2 # via # -r requirements/test.txt # pylint # pylint-celery attrs==22.2.0 # via -r requirements/test.txt binaryornot==0.4.4 # via # -r requirements/test.txt # cookiecutter bleach==6.0.0 # via # -r requirements/test.txt # readme-renderer boto==2.49.0 # via # -r requirements/test.txt # xblock-sdk boto3==1.26.104 # via # -r requirements/test.txt # fs-s3fs botocore==1.29.104 # via # -r requirements/test.txt # boto3 # s3transfer certifi==2022.12.7 # via # -r requirements/test.txt # requests cffi==1.15.1 # via # -r requirements/test.txt # cryptography # pynacl chardet==5.1.0 # via # -r requirements/test.txt # binaryornot charset-normalizer==3.1.0 # via # -r requirements/test.txt # requests click==8.1.3 # via # -r requirements/test.txt # click-log # code-annotations # cookiecutter # edx-django-utils # edx-lint click-log==0.4.0 # via # -r requirements/test.txt # edx-lint code-annotations==1.3.0 # via # -r requirements/test.txt # edx-lint cookiecutter==2.1.1 # via # -r requirements/test.txt # xblock-sdk coverage==6.5.0 # via # -r requirements/test.txt # coveralls coveralls==3.3.1 # via -r requirements/test.txt cryptography==40.0.1 # via # -r requirements/test.txt # secretstorage ddt==1.6.0 # via -r requirements/test.txt dill==0.3.6 # via # -r requirements/test.txt # pylint distlib==0.3.6 # via # -r requirements/tox.txt # virtualenv django==3.2.18 # via # -c requirements/common_constraints.txt # -r requirements/test.txt # django-config-models # django-crum # django-filter # djangorestframework # edx-django-utils # jsonfield # openedx-django-pyfs # openedx-filters # xblock-sdk django-config-models==2.3.0 # via -r requirements/test.txt django-crum==0.7.9 # via # -r requirements/test.txt # edx-django-utils django-filter==23.1 # via -r requirements/test.txt django-waffle==3.0.0 # via # -r requirements/test.txt # edx-django-utils djangorestframework==3.14.0 # via # -r requirements/test.txt # django-config-models docopt==0.6.2 # via # -r requirements/test.txt # coveralls docutils==0.19 # via # -r requirements/test.txt # readme-renderer edx-django-utils==5.3.0 # via # -r requirements/test.txt # django-config-models edx-lint==5.3.4 # via -r requirements/test.txt edx-opaque-keys[django]==2.3.0 # via -r requirements/test.txt filelock==3.10.7 # via # -r requirements/tox.txt # tox # virtualenv fs==2.4.16 # via # -r requirements/test.txt # fs-s3fs # openedx-django-pyfs # xblock fs-s3fs==1.1.1 # via # -r requirements/test.txt # openedx-django-pyfs # xblock-sdk future==0.18.3 # via # -r requirements/test.txt # pyjwkest idna==3.4 # via # -r requirements/test.txt # requests importlib-metadata==6.1.0 # via # -r requirements/test.txt # keyring # twine importlib-resources==5.12.0 # via # -r requirements/test.txt # keyring isort==5.12.0 # via # -r requirements/test.txt # pylint jaraco-classes==3.2.3 # via # -r requirements/test.txt # keyring jeepney==0.8.0 # via # -r requirements/test.txt # keyring # secretstorage jinja2==3.1.2 # via # -r requirements/test.txt # code-annotations # cookiecutter # jinja2-time jinja2-time==0.2.0 # via # -r requirements/test.txt # cookiecutter jmespath==1.0.1 # via # -r requirements/test.txt # boto3 # botocore jsonfield==3.1.0 # via -r requirements/test.txt keyring==23.13.1 # via # -r requirements/test.txt # twine lazy==1.5 # via # -r requirements/test.txt # xblock lazy-object-proxy==1.9.0 # via # -r requirements/test.txt # astroid lxml==4.9.2 # via # -r requirements/test.txt # xblock # xblock-sdk mako==1.2.4 # via # -r requirements/test.txt # xblock-utils markdown-it-py==2.2.0 # via # -r requirements/test.txt # rich markupsafe==2.1.2 # via # -r requirements/test.txt # jinja2 # mako # xblock mccabe==0.7.0 # via # -r requirements/test.txt # pylint mdurl==0.1.2 # via # -r requirements/test.txt # markdown-it-py mock==5.0.1 # via -r requirements/test.txt more-itertools==9.1.0 # via # -r requirements/test.txt # jaraco-classes newrelic==8.8.0 # via # -r requirements/test.txt # edx-django-utils oauthlib==3.2.2 # via -r requirements/test.txt openedx-django-pyfs==3.2.1 # via # -r requirements/test.txt # xblock openedx-filters==1.2.0 # via -r requirements/test.txt packaging==23.0 # via # -r requirements/tox.txt # tox pbr==5.11.1 # via # -r requirements/test.txt # stevedore pkginfo==1.9.6 # via # -r requirements/test.txt # twine platformdirs==3.2.0 # via # -r requirements/test.txt # -r requirements/tox.txt # pylint # virtualenv pluggy==1.0.0 # via # -r requirements/tox.txt # tox psutil==5.9.4 # via # -r requirements/test.txt # edx-django-utils py==1.11.0 # via # -r requirements/tox.txt # tox pycodestyle==2.10.0 # via -r requirements/test.txt pycparser==2.21 # via # -r requirements/test.txt # cffi pycryptodomex==3.17 # via # -r requirements/test.txt # pyjwkest pygments==2.14.0 # via # -r requirements/test.txt # readme-renderer # rich pyjwkest==1.4.2 # via -r requirements/test.txt pylint==2.17.2 # via # -r requirements/test.txt # edx-lint # pylint-celery # pylint-django # pylint-plugin-utils pylint-celery==0.3 # via # -r requirements/test.txt # edx-lint pylint-django==2.5.3 # via # -r requirements/test.txt # edx-lint pylint-plugin-utils==0.7 # via # -r requirements/test.txt # pylint-celery # pylint-django pymongo==3.13.0 # via # -r requirements/test.txt # edx-opaque-keys pynacl==1.5.0 # via # -r requirements/test.txt # edx-django-utils pypng==0.20220715.0 # via # -r requirements/test.txt # xblock-sdk python-dateutil==2.8.2 # via # -r requirements/test.txt # arrow # botocore # xblock python-slugify==8.0.1 # via # -r requirements/test.txt # code-annotations # cookiecutter pytz==2023.3 # via # -r requirements/test.txt # django # djangorestframework # xblock pyyaml==6.0 # via # -r requirements/test.txt # code-annotations # cookiecutter # xblock readme-renderer==37.3 # via # -r requirements/test.txt # twine requests==2.28.2 # via # -r requirements/test.txt # cookiecutter # coveralls # pyjwkest # requests-toolbelt # twine # xblock-sdk requests-toolbelt==0.10.1 # via # -r requirements/test.txt # twine rfc3986==2.0.0 # via # -r requirements/test.txt # twine rich==13.3.3 # via # -r requirements/test.txt # twine s3transfer==0.6.0 # via # -r requirements/test.txt # boto3 secretstorage==3.3.3 # via # -r requirements/test.txt # keyring simplejson==3.18.4 # via # -r requirements/test.txt # xblock-sdk # xblock-utils six==1.16.0 # via # -r requirements/test.txt # -r requirements/tox.txt # bleach # edx-lint # fs # fs-s3fs # pyjwkest # python-dateutil # tox sqlparse==0.4.3 # via # -r requirements/test.txt # django stevedore==5.0.0 # via # -r requirements/test.txt # code-annotations # edx-django-utils # edx-opaque-keys text-unidecode==1.3 # via # -r requirements/test.txt # python-slugify tomli==2.0.1 # via # -r requirements/test.txt # -r requirements/tox.txt # pylint # tox tomlkit==0.11.7 # via # -r requirements/test.txt # pylint tox==3.28.0 # via # -c requirements/common_constraints.txt # -r requirements/tox.txt twine==4.0.2 # via -r requirements/test.txt typing-extensions==4.5.0 # via # -r requirements/test.txt # astroid # pylint # rich urllib3==1.26.15 # via # -r requirements/test.txt # botocore # requests # twine virtualenv==20.21.0 # via # -r requirements/tox.txt # tox web-fragments==2.0.0 # via # -r requirements/test.txt # xblock # xblock-sdk # xblock-utils webencodings==0.5.1 # via # -r requirements/test.txt # bleach webob==1.8.7 # via # -r requirements/test.txt # xblock # xblock-sdk wrapt==1.15.0 # via # -r requirements/test.txt # astroid xblock[django]==1.6.2 # via # -r requirements/test.txt # xblock-sdk # xblock-utils xblock-sdk==0.5.4 # via -r requirements/test.txt xblock-utils==3.0.0 # via -r requirements/test.txt zipp==3.15.0 # via # -r requirements/test.txt # importlib-metadata # importlib-resources # The following packages are considered to be unsafe in a requirements file: # setuptools